Affidavit submitted before the Nanavati Commission

I, S. Gurmail Singh, S/o S. Dharam Singh, age 50 years, R/o H-78E, Palam Colony, Raj Nagar near New Gurdwara, New Delhi-45 do hereby solemnly affirm and declare as under:-

1. That I purchased Plot No. RZ-261 / B/ 36, Raj Nagar, Palam Colony, New Delhi in 1975. I built the house and was staying there with my family members.

2. That on 1st November '84, at about 0930 hours a mob came and first burnt the Gurdwara Sahib of Raj Nagar.

3. That then the mob was approaching towards my home, I left the home and took shelter in the neighbour's house.

4. That I saw the mob looting and burning my house.

5. That at night I cut my hair and left the neighbour's house and went to Palam Airport.

6. I stayed at Palam Airport till 07-11-84.

7. That I suffered a loss of Rs. 70,000/- due to burning of my house and household goods.

8. That I have received no compensation so far whatsoever from the Govt.

9. I request that I may be given compensation for the loss of my property and household goods.
